Understanding Glass Gabions
At its core, a gabion is a wire mesh cage filled with rocks or other materials. Traditional gabion walls have long been used for erosion control, landscaping, and retaining walls. However, the introduction of glass into the gabion design adds a significant aesthetic dimension. Glass gabions are cages that contain glass pieces – either clear, colored, or frosted – creating an eye-catching feature that can reflect, refract, and transmit light in fascinating ways.
Benefits of Glass Gabion Walls
1. Aesthetic Versatility One of the primary draws of glass gabion walls is their beauty. Unlike traditional stone gabion walls, which can appear austere and overly industrial, glass gabions introduce vibrancy and elegance to any landscape. They can be tailored to fit various design themes and can serve as an artistic statement in gardens, parks, or urban settings.
2. Environmental Consideration The use of recycled glass in gabions contributes to sustainability. Glass is a material that can be repurposed, reducing waste and minimizing the environmental impact associated with new raw material extraction. Manufacturers often source glass from post-consumer products, redirecting waste from landfills and giving it a new life in building applications.
3. Durability and Maintenance Glass gabions are inherently durable. The tempered glass used in their construction is designed to withstand the elements, making them suitable for outdoor use. Furthermore, because they are often filled with glass pieces, they can resist degradation over time, maintaining their structural integrity. Cleaning can be as simple as rinsing them with water, ensuring they look pristine with minimal effort.
4. Functional Privacy and Noise Reduction In addition to their aesthetic qualities, glass gabion walls can also serve practical purposes. They can be designed to offer privacy in urban environments or to reduce noise from bustling roads or neighbor activities. The strategic placement of these walls can create serene outdoor spaces that are both private and peaceful.
5. Versatile Applications Glass gabions can be utilized in various contexts, ranging from residential gardens to commercial properties. Along pathways, as fences, or even as unique art installations, their adaptable nature allows architects and designers to explore countless possibilities in construction and landscaping.
